"Labourites [affiliates of the British Labour Party] would have a strong incentive to cooperate: Neal Lawson, head of Labour-affiliated think tank Compass, warned that the alternative was irrelevance."
'If we are now in an era of three party politics then the party that fails to build a partnership condemns itself to the wilderness.'
